Hostos Review/ Revista Hostosiana no. 16

Hostos Review/Revista Hostosiana no. 16, Escritura contemporánea queer en inglés y español en las Américas/ Contemporary Queer Writing in English and Spanish in the Americas was published on October 2, 2020.

Composed and prefaced by guest editors Dr. Claudia Salazar Jiménez and Dr. Larry La Fountain-Stokes, the issue includes poetry, fiction, and chronicle in English or Spanish by eighteen contributing authors from across the Americas: Achy Obejas, Charles Rice-González, Clara Inés Giraldo Mejía, Gabby De Cicco, Gisela Kozak, Johan Mijail, Juan Pablo Sutherland, Laura Arnés, Mariana Docampo, Odette Alonso, Raquel Gutierrez, Raquel Salas Rivera, Rigoberto Gonzalez, SaSa Testa, Susana Chávez-Silverman, Urayoán Noel, Vero Ferrari and Yolanda Arroyo Pizarro.

The issue was conceived of as a space for authors and scholars to engage in a much-needed trans-American dialogue about what it means to write queer/cuir literature nowadays in Latin America, the Caribbean, and the United States.

On the cover, the remarkable piece of photographic artwork, “Sylvia Rivera (with Christina Hayworth and Julia Murray,” was donated to the journal by renowned Puerto Rican photographer Luis Carle. The photograph is also held at the Smithsonian’s National Portrait Gallery.
